Personal injury law is a branch of civil law that allows individuals who have been harmed due to others’ negligence to seek financial remedies. This area focuses on holding responsible parties accountable and providing monetary relief for injuries, pain, and losses sustained. It serves as a mechanism to promote safety and fairness in society.
A successful personal injury claim involves proving duty of care, breach of that duty, causation, and damages. Attorneys gather evidence such as medical records, witness statements, and accident reports. The process also includes filing claims, negotiating settlements, and preparing for trial if necessary, to ensure clients receive just compensation.
Familiarity with key legal terms can help clients better understand their case. These terms define critical concepts and procedures relevant to personal injury claims and litigation.
Liability refers to the legal responsibility one party has for causing harm to another. In personal injury cases, establishing liability is essential for proving that the defendant is accountable for the injuries sustained.
Damages are the monetary compensation awarded to an injured party for losses suffered, including medical expenses, lost income, and pain and suffering. Calculating damages accurately is vital to securing fair restitution.
Negligence occurs when a person or entity fails to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to another. Proving negligence is a cornerstone in many personal injury claims.
A settlement is an agreement reached between parties to resolve a personal injury case without going to trial. Settlements provide a quicker resolution and often involve compensation negotiated between attorneys and insurance companies.

In a personal injury case, you may recover various types of damages including medical expenses, lost wages, property damage, and compensation for pain and suffering. These damages address both the financial and non-financial impacts of the injury. Your attorney will assess your unique situation to determine all applicable damages. This comprehensive approach helps ensure you receive compensation that fully accounts for your losses and future needs.

Yes, you can still file a claim even if you were partially at fault for the accident under New York’s comparative negligence laws. Your compensation may be reduced by your percentage of fault but you may still recover damages. An attorney can help determine fault percentages and advocate for your maximum possible recovery despite shared responsibility.
Personal injury attorneys typically work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they receive a percentage of the settlement or award only if you win your case. This arrangement allows clients to pursue claims without upfront legal fees. The specific fee percentage and any additional costs will be clearly explained during your initial consultation so you understand the financial terms before proceeding.

To prove negligence, you must show that the other party owed you a duty of care, breached that duty, and caused your injuries as a result. Evidence such as witness statements, accident reports, and expert testimony can support your claim. Your attorney will gather and organize this evidence to build a strong case demonstrating the opposing party’s responsibility for your damages.
